1200W how many kwh does the electric heater consume?

1200/1000 =1.2 kwh/hour.

1 degree = 1000 watt, 1 hour = 1 kwh.

The formula for finding power is power = work/time. Power is a physical quantity representing the speed of doing work, and power is equal to the scalar product of the acting force and the speed of the point where the object is stressed.

In our daily life, we often call power horse power, just as we call torque torsion.

In the automobile field, the biggest working machine is the engine. Engine power is calculated by torque, and the formula is quite simple: power (w)=2π× torque (Nm)× speed (rpm)/60. After simplified calculation, it becomes: power (W)= torque (Nm)× rotational speed (rpm)/9.549.

Because of the difference between English and metric systems, the definition of horsepower is basically different. British horsepower (hp) is defined as: a horse pulls an object weighing 200 pounds (lb) 165 feet (ft) in one minute, which is equal to 33,000 pounds feet/minute after multiplication.

Metric horsepower (PS) is defined as a horse pulling a 75kg object for 60m in one minute, which is equal to 4500kg.g.m/min after multiplication.

After unit conversion, (1lb = 0.454kg; 1ft=0.3048m) unexpected discovery 1hp=4566kgm/min, slightly different from the metric 1ps = 4500kg.m/min.

And if converted into watts (1w =1nm/sec =1/9.8kg.m/sec), it is1HP = 746w; 1ps=735W, two different results, the difference is about 1.5%.

DIN in Germany, EEC in Europe and JIS in Japan are all based on metric PS, while hp in Britain is used in SAE.

However, due to the arrival of the global economy, in order to avoid complicated conversion, more and more original factory data are changed to provide the undisputed international standard unit kW kW as the engine power output value.
